fury

n.
1.a feeling of intense anger
2.state of violent mental agitation
3.the property of being wild or turbulent
4.(classical mythology) the hideous snake-haired monsters (usually three in number) who pursued unpunished criminals

  • Idiom of the Day

    throw down the gauntlet
    to challenge someone to a fight or to do something
    The government threw down the gauntlet to the opposition party and told them to stop criticizing their policies without suggesting an alternative.
